Safe Working Practices within Enclosures for Registered Training Organisations

This thorough guide outlines the essential safety procedures that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) must comply with when conducting work in confined spaces. Understanding and implementing these guidelines is crucial for ensuring the safety and well-being of personnel engaged in tasks within potentially dangerous areas.

Prior to commencing any work|Before initiating operations|Upon entering a confined space|, it is imperative for RTOs to conduct a detailed site analysis to identify potential dangers. This methodology must encompass factors such as the task being performed, the environmental factors present, and the risk of hazardous gases.

  • Implement a safe system of work that entails clear procedures for entry, exit, monitoring, and emergency action
  • Provide workers with app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) tailored to the specific hazards present
  • Ensure continuous monitoring of atmospheric conditions using calibrated instruments and trained personnel
  • Develop a method for reliable worker-to-supervisor communication

Regular training and education|are vital to maintain awareness with safe work practices in confined spaces. RTOs ought to undertake regular practice scenarios to familiarize workers with emergency procedures and improve their response capabilities.
